Smog or Pollution?

Exerpt from "Pure Joy" by Alicia Britt Chole

A murky, gray, haze lurks over the city.
The locals call it “smog.” Visitors know it is pollution.
Some optimistically wait for the sun to come out and the winds to change. Others guess correctly that the sun has been blocked out and unless choices change, the “smog” will endure.
We smile at such obvious rewriting of reality, but we need to smile cautiously. Most of us have a keen ability to edit reality and excuse ourselves from responsibility.
We call slander, “sharing.”
Toying with temptation is dismissed as, “harmless curiosity.”
Lack of discipline is justified under the label of “temperament.”
Self is dressed up and renamed “focused.”
How easy it is to deceive ourselves and accept poison in our lives.
Sin is similar to pollution. It is man-made through the power of choice. Unless dealt with aggressively, sin gathers, deepens, and obscures Truth. Calling it “smog” will not make it going away. Only when we acknowledge sin for the pollution it really is in our lives can the clean up effort begin.
God Himself stands ready to champion that clean up effort. His assistance arrives the very moment we move from denial to repentance.
